以太坊钱包转账原理解析

      发布时间:2024-11-25 07:46:06

      以太坊钱包转账原理解析

      以太坊(Ethereum)是一种去中心化的区块链平台,允许开发者构建和部署智能合约和去中心化应用(DApps)。作为以太坊生态系统的重要组成部分,钱包(Wallet)在用户进行转账、存储和管理以太币(ETH)及其他基于以太坊的代币时,起着关键的作用。本文将深入探讨以太坊钱包转账的原理,包括其技术基础、交易流程、涉及的安全问题以及常见的转账问题。

      1. 以太坊钱包的基本概念

      以太坊钱包是用户用来管理以太币和其他代币的工具。它们分为热钱包和冷钱包两种类型:

      • 热钱包: 在线钱包,通常是基于平台或软件的,如Web钱包或移动应用。热钱包便于使用,但由于它们常常连接到互联网,因此安全性较低,面对黑客攻击的风险。
      • 冷钱包: 离线钱包,包括硬件钱包和纸钱包。冷钱包因为不与互联网连接,所以通常被认为是更安全的选择,适合存储大笔资产。

      以太坊钱包通过生成一对公钥和私钥来实现资产的管理。公钥表示钱包地址,可以公开给他人以接收资金,而私钥则是钱包的“密码”,用于授权转账和管理资产。用户必须确保其私钥的安全,因为任何拥有私钥的人都可以控制相应的钱包资金。

      2. 以太坊转账的基本原理

      以太坊的转账流程涉及多个步骤,每个步骤都在区块链上进行验证。以下是转账过程的主要组成部分:

      • 创建交易: 用户通过钱包界面输入接收方的以太坊地址、转账金额及其手续费(通常称为“Gas费”),这是矿工为处理交易所必需的费用。
      • 签名交易: 创建交易后,钱包会使用用户的私钥对交易信息进行签名。这一过程确保了只有拥有私钥的人才能发起转账,保证了交易的真实性和不可否认性。
      • 广播交易: 交易被签名后,钱包会将其广播到以太坊网络,等待矿工进行验证。
      • 矿工验证交易: 矿工通过计算数学难题,利用工作量证明机制(PoW)进行交易验证,并将有效交易打包成新区块添加到区块链中。
      • 确认交易: 一旦交易被区块链接收并包含在块中,便会逐步确认。确认的数量越多,交易的安全性就越高,对应接收方也就越能确认已收到相应的以太币。

      3. 以太坊转账中的安全问题

      以太坊转账过程中的安全性是一个重要话题,主要包括以下几个方面:

      • 私钥保护: 私钥是控制以太坊钱包资金的关键,用户应该确保私钥不被泄露。可以采用多重签名、硬件钱包等方式来增强安全性。
      • 网络攻击: 由于热钱包连接互联网,易受到黑客攻击。因此,用户应该选择可靠的钱包服务,并定期更新软件以提高安全性。
      • 钓鱼攻击: 用户应警惕钓鱼攻击,确保只在官方网站或可信网站输入钱包信息或进行转账。
      • Gas费不当设置: 在转账时,设定过低的Gas费可能导致交易被延迟或者不被矿工处理,导致交易失败而资金锁定。

      4. 常见的转账问题与解决方案

      在以太坊转账过程中,用户可能会遇到一些常见问题,以下是几种常见问题及其解决方案:

      • 交易未确认: 如果交易在一段时间内未被确认,建议检查Gas费是否设置合理,重新发送交易时适当提高Gas费。
      • 发错地址: 以太坊地址一旦发出无法更改或撤回。建议每次转账前仔细检查接收方地址。
      • 私钥丢失: 丢失私钥会导致无法恢复钱包资产。用户应定期备份私钥并存储于安全的地方。
      • 钱包软件出错: 可能因为软件bug导致错误或崩溃,建议保持钱包软件更新,并定期查看官方公告。

      总结

      以太坊钱包的转账原理涉及多个技术环节,包括交易的创建、签名、验证及确认等。了解这些原理和相关安全问题,可以帮助用户在进行以太坊转账时减少错误和风险。无论是新手还是经验丰富的用户,都应重视钱包的安全性和转账的准确性,以便在这个去中心化的领域中安全地管理自己的资产。

      思考相关问题

      在深入了解以太坊钱包转账原理后,我们可以提出以下四个相关问题,并分别进行详细探讨。

      问1:如何选择安全的以太坊钱包?

      选择一个安全可靠的以太坊钱包是确保资产安全的第一步。以下是一些选择钱包时应考虑的关键因素:

      • 信誉和口碑: 选择声誉良好的钱包,查看用户评价和安全事件历史,确保其信誉度较高。
      • 安全性功能: 检查钱包提供的安全功能,比如两步验证、多重签名、冷存储选项等,以降低黑客攻击的风险。
      • 易用性: 钱包界面的友好程度、操作的便捷性直接影响用户的使用体验,选择易于使用的工具可以减少误操作的几率。
      • 代币支持: 确认钱包是否支持您需要管理的所有代币,不同钱包对ERC20及ERC721等代币的支持情况不同。

      此外,可自行查询该钱包的开发团队背景、技术实力及开源情况。如果可能,选择开源钱包该是个不错的选择,因为它们的代码可供审计,安全性更可控。

      问2:以太坊转账的处理速度如何?

      以太坊转账的处理速度受多种因素影响,包括网络拥堵程度、Gas费的设置、矿工的确认速度等。在正常情况下,以太坊网络的区块生成时间约为15秒,但在网络高峰期间,交易处理可能会受到影响。

      用户可以通过在转账过程中设置更高的Gas费来提高交易的优先级,从而加快确认速度。在使用支持实时行情的以太坊钱包时,建议根据当前网络状态实时调整Gas费,以避免转账延迟。

      问3:如果转账金额错误该怎么办?

      一旦以太坊交易提交并被矿工确认,交易便无法撤回。因此,在进行转账前,用户必须严格检查接收地址和转账金额。如果不小心转账至错误地址,唯一的补救措施是与接收方联系,请求其退还资金。

      所以,转账前要特别注意意外输入的地址和金额,以免造成不必要的损失。此外,某些钱包会提供地址验证功能,帮助用户在发出交易前确认,减少错误发生的可能性。

      问4:如何处理以太坊转账的手续费?

      在以太坊转账时,手续费(Gas费)是不可避免的,这是矿工处理和验证交易的主要动力。手续费会影响交易的处理优先级,用户可以根据市场情况调整手续费的高低。

      用户在进行转账时,应当对Gas费的设定有充分认识,既要保证手续费足够高以确保交易顺利被确认,也要考虑手续费的合理性,避免因过高的手续费导致转账成本的浪费。一些钱包会提供实时Gas费参考,帮助用户更好地进行决策。

      结语

      了解以太坊钱包转账的原理及相关的问题,有助于用户在使用以太坊区块链进行交易时,实现安全、高效的资产管理。随着技术的不断发展,用户也应随时关注以太坊及数字货币领域的新动态,以提高自身的安全意识和使用能力。

      分享 :
                author

                tpwallet

                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                            相关新闻

                                            标题:以太坊钱包的种类与
                                            2024-11-13
                                            标题:以太坊钱包的种类与

                                            --- 引言 随着区块链技术的不断发展,以太坊作为一种广泛使用的智能合约平台,其生态系统也日渐丰富。其中,以太...

                                            区块链数字钱包的业务功
                                            2024-10-16
                                            区块链数字钱包的业务功

                                            随着区块链技术的发展和数字货币的逐渐普及,数字钱包作为存储和管理数字资产的重要工具,受到越来越多用户的...

                                            USDT提币到云钱包的详细指
                                            2024-11-18
                                            USDT提币到云钱包的详细指

                                            在数字货币交易日益普及的今天,各类数字资产的安全存储显得尤为重要。USDT(泰达币)作为一种以美元为基础的稳...

                                            比特币钱包模式详解:如
                                            2024-11-10
                                            比特币钱包模式详解:如

                                            比特币作为一种数字货币,自2009年问世以来,逐渐吸引了全球用户的关注。而要想有效地存储和管理比特币,钱包的...